    Hi, thank you for the information. Do you mind elaborating on on the part where you mentioned "not getting paid" as a reservist and points. Thank you.

    • @CGCareerCentral
      @CGCareerCentral  Рік тому +1

      Haha yes I did kind of gloss over that part quickly didn't I. I'll make a video answer, but the short answer is you've got your 48 drill periods required per year (paid), but sometimes the job involves time beyond that, and unless you are doing active duty, that extra time is unpaid (but still counts for your retirement).

    Appreciate your insights. Just graduated college and considering joining the reserves in the near future. How accommodating is the CG in stationing you close to where you work/live? Also wondering if there’s a difference in this regard for enlistment VS officer membership.

    • @CGCareerCentral
      @CGCareerCentral  Рік тому

      For the reserve side, the Coast Guard will make every effort to have you within a reasonable commuting distance from home. Keep in mind this relies on how close you are to a station that has openings for your job.

    • @CGCareerCentral
      @CGCareerCentral  Рік тому

      Officers tend to have to commute further for their job because as you move higher in ranks, there are less amounts of jobs available.

    Thank you for this video! I am 27, I have a B.S., and I just got an MBA. I am considering joining the Coast Guard Officer Corps, and I'm curious if Reserve Corps is a viable option for me. What is the process for transforming from a civilian into a reserve officer, and will I suffer for not having active duty experience? I want to attempt to join as a reservist first, so that I can keep my civilian job, and then potentially switch to active duty in a few years depending on if I can be accepted to basic flight school. Any feedback on my plan?

    • @wtb212
      @wtb212 7 місяців тому

      You get any answers? I’m in almost exact same boat..

    • @MarsellusWallace2024
      @MarsellusWallace2024 6 місяців тому

      Reserve Officer Candidate Indoctrination (ROCI pronounced”Rocky”) may be a good course for you. It’s a 2 week “knife and fork” school to train folks to be reserve officers. Call your nearest CG recruiter and tell him your situation and ask about going to “Rocky”. Just tell them a retired Chief sent you.

    Can u get education benefits in coast guard reserve. Here in my state the national guard will pay all your school for a 6 year contract

    • @CGCareerCentral
      @CGCareerCentral  Місяць тому

      Yes, you can get up to $4,500 a year in tuition assistance for accredited colleges. You can also qualify for the Post 9/11 GI Bill for 6 years of service.

    Is it always 2 days a month? Does it ever change? Do you ever have to do a couple of weeks?

    • @CGCareerCentral
      @CGCareerCentral  9 місяців тому +1

      2 days a month is the standard. Some Commands will allow you to do 3 days (Fri-Sun or Sat-Mon) and then you only go in 8 months a year. Or if something comes up and they need assistance during the week, though generally if that happens they would put you on Active Duty orders.
